Claremont-McKenna College Tennis Center, NTD Architects,
Inc. Airbrushed styrene showing University colors on tennis
court surfaces. Court line work in white Prism color pencil.
Court nets and fences in airbrushed enamel on etched brass.
Species-specific trees of twisted copper wire armature and
crushed foam.
Multi-family residence, Las Angeles, CA Airbrushed flat and
patterned sheet, shaped foam and etched brass. This large-
scale condominium model presented a very challenging mask-
ing operation to achieve clean surface finishing in highly con-
trasting colors. The scale also demanded a high degree of
interior finishing treatment due to the large glass areas and
visual access to interior spaces.
University Medical Center, Phoenix, AZ, NTD Architects, Inc.,
San Diego, CA Airbrushed styrene and polycarbonate on
shaped foam base. This project required pre-assembly and
pre-finishing of many building components due to its “additive”
design solution.
